PRESS RELEASE
Olivia Wingate Productions presents
GOD’S POTTERY SAVES THE WORLD
EDINBURGH FRINGE FESTIVAL 2007
PLEASANCE COURTYARD, THE CAVERN
6.40pm (Ends 7.40pm)
2nd – 27th AUGUST 2007 (not 15th or 22nd)
They’re back! God’s Pottery, last year’s runaway hit of the festival is back with a brand new show. This time they’re not just talking about saving one little boy from Harlem, but the entire world. With all new songs, Christian folk rockers Gideon Lamb and Jeremiah Smallchild take on more global issues like adoption, drug addiction, and Africa in an effort to save all mankind through the power of song, true belief, and a PowerPoint™ presentation. God help us all.
